News that the Supreme Court of New South Wales was unable to determine whether the provisions of Fonterra’s licensing agreement with Bega Cheese are impacted by a divestment process, do not change its plans, Fonterra says. The co-op is currently running a dual-track process, pursuing potentially a trade sale and initial public offering (IPO), to divest its global consumer business and integrated businesses, Fonterra Oceania and Sri Lanka.It registered Mainland Group Holdings on April 1 and said it would be the top entity sold in a tr...
